THEATRE lovers in Helensburgh are being invited to make the short trip to Dumbarton for a parody of the famous novel The 39 Steps next month.
The Dumbarton People’s Theatre group is putting on four performances of Patrick Barlow’s comedy – written in 2005 and adapted from the 1915 novel by John Buchan and the 1935 film by Alfred Hitchcock – at the Denny Civic Theatre from March 1-4.
Tickets (£5) are available from the Scandinavian Shop in Helensburgh as well as McDermid’s Keystore in Dumbarton.
The doors open each night at 7pm and the curtain goes up at 7.30pm.
